Standard Chartered PLC is the leading banking group in the emerging countries. Net banking product breaks down by activity as follows: - commercial, corporate, investment, and market banking (58.3%): business financing, credit unions, sales of structured products, cash and rate management, security compensation and conservation, fund management, etc.; - retail and private banking (39.8%): sale of products and traditional banking services, issue of credit cards, consumer and real estate loans, small and medium business loans, on-line banking, etc.; - other (1.9%). At the end of 2025, the group had USD 530.2 billion in current deposits and USD 286.8 billion in current loans. Income is distributed geographically as follows: the United Kingdom (8%), Hong Kong (25.6%), Singapore (14.6%), India (7.2%), the United States (5.8%), the United Arab Emirates (5.6%), China (5.5%), South Korea (5.2%), Taiwan (2.8%) and other (19.7%).
